(Massena) The United States will celebrate its 250th anniversary—also known as the Semiquincentennial—on July 4, 2026, marking 250 years since the signing of the Declaration of Independence. To commemorate the milestone, the Massena Chamber of Commerce is hosting a two-day celebration, beginning Friday, July 3.
The Chamber hosted a community meeting on Tuesday to gather feedback and recruit volunteers for the festivities.
Chamber Vice-President Doug Venteicher says the event already has strong community backing, with several residents stepping up to help. One decision is set in stone: the parade, which will take place at 10 a.m. on Saturday, July 4.
Activities discussed at the meeting include a kids’ parade, adult scavenger hunts, a bag tournament, pedal pulls, a foam party, and a beer garden. Other possible events still being considered include a fun run, “keg and eggs,” park games, bingo, an Ag Adventure, inflatables, a tractor and car show, and an all-class reunion.
The planning committee will continue meeting monthly in preparation for the celebration.
